Address 0 PPC

P8fMRhVGHdnNqLZRA2BX5ZFJsJxFS3aWQ7

Confirmed

Total Received285 PPC
Total Sent285 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
702582 Confirmations3250.00007 PPC
PXLyyg1LvrbsCRNSsJ75iFqUoSD99KQCKk114.99 PPC
P8fMRhVGHdnNqLZRA2BX5ZFJsJxFS3aWQ7285 PPC
Fee: 0.01 PPC
705968 Confirmations399.99 PPC